The Boston Globe USA Nation September 22, 2022
PROVIDENCE — A federal judge on Wednesday said Rhode Island’s truck tolls violate the US Constitution, blocking the state from collecting or charging them.US District Judge William Smith’s 91-page decision comes after a bench trial earlier this year. Smith wrote that the... + más
